SECTION 40:10-3-1. Qualifications and requirements for breath-alcohol operators (initial permits)
Latest version.
- (1) Must be a qualified employee of a recognized Oklahoma law enforcement agency, or the Board of Tests for Alcohol and Drug Influence. Employees of Federal or Tribal law enforcement agencies, tasked with conducting breath tests, may obtain a permit under the same conditions as employees of recognized Oklahoma law enforcement agencies, at the discretion of the Federal or Tribal law enforcement agency. Nothing in this rule requires the employees of Federal or Tribal law enforcement agencies to obtain a permit to conduct breath tests in support of Federal or Tribal enforcement.(2) Satisfactory completion, within 1 year prior to application for an Operator permit, of a course of instruction in breath-alcohol analysis acceptable to the Board of Tests for Alcohol and Drug Influence.(3) Establishment, to the satisfaction of the Board of Tests for Alcohol and Drug Influence, of the applicant's competence to operate Board approved breath test instrument(s).
